Re: [j-nsp] Error while validating a JunOS

2012-11-30 Thread Alex Arseniev

Jinstall validates both current _AND_ rescue config.
Check if you have rescue config set and if yes then overwrite it with 
current config

request system config rescue save

[j-nsp] Error while validating a JunOS

2012-11-29 Thread Ali Sumsam
Hi,
I have a brand new MX5 router for one of my customers. The only
configuration I have on this router is

1, one login name and password
2, IP address on FXP0
3, telnet and ftp service.

I have uploaded Junos jinstall-ppc-11.2R5.4-export-signed.tgz, which is the
recommended one for MX5 on juniper site.


When i try to validate this JunOS, it gives me following error.

mgd: error: configuration check-out failed
Validation failed
WARNING: Current configuration not compatible with
/var/tmp/jinstall-ppc-11.2R5.4-export-signed.tgz

Any suggestion. Can I just ignore this error and live with it?
